I don't own any of those, so all I'll say is second hand knowledge. Innokin makes good batteries. Vamo is very popular, but it's not the highest quality mod. If you want a quick upgrade while you wait, any of them will do. Just remember that if you decide to get an APV with replaceable battery, like the Vamo, you'll also need to add a charger and batteries.

Tough call. The MVP2 is great and reliable, but a bit boring in comparison with the istick, which is small and fun and powerful but completely unpredictable--it won't fire below 4.2v and the 510 connection is mushy... :facepalm:

I like the looks of the MVP 20W (what I think people are calling the MVP 3), because it is 510 flush. That said it hasn't been released yet & someone said it is expensive.

Be sure you check what ohms the device can handle. Even if you aren't into rebuilding there are plenty of sub-ohm clearomizer & coils coming out. If you have any interest in trying or using them you are going to need the right device.

I bought a couple of DNA 30 clones for my kids from fasttech. With batteries they were $48 each or something like that. Before everyone growns about fasttech. They were at my house 11 days after ordering.

Lots of power yet will go down to 7 watts to fire stock coils. This would be my vote. If you like vaping you are going to end up with a few "Back Ups". I have a mech, a box mod, and an ego twist I still use.
